Top 5 Free Online Dating Websites

Online dating isn't odd nowadays with 12% of the American population using sites to find their perfect match. If you're looking for a website that works for you, here are the top five free online dating services you can use to find a suitable partner.

1. Plenty of Fish

Plenty of Fish took the old saying, "There's plenty of fish in the sea," and used it to create this website — which has been featured on Fox, CNN, and USA Today, to name a few. Over three million people use Plenty of Fish daily, and it works similar to other sites in the business. When you join, you’re given a test that’s designed to discover which personalities you’re most compatible with. From there, you can view profiles, message people you are interested in, arrange dates, and get your love life on the right track.

2. OkCupid

OkCupid is certainly a popular dating service, that’s been around since 2004, with hundreds of thousands of people online at any given time. The website boasts about the fact that it offers top-notch services without forcing users to pay — although additional features on the site do require payment. Once you sign up, you'll have to complete a questionnaire. Using this quiz, the site will find people with similar interests and desires so that they can find the best match possible. The questions range from how messy you are to whether or not you've cheated in a relationship.

3. Match

Match, originally Singles.net, was launched in 1995 — which makes it one of the oldest online dating services in the business. With a free online account, you can create a profile, post photos, search for singles near you, send and receive winks, and use the matching system to find potential dates. Additionally, you’ll have access to the app through your mobile device so you can browse, meet, and talk to singles in your area on the go.

4. eHarmony

The founder of eHarmony was a psychologist who counseled thousands of married couples. After a while, he realized that there were certain personal characteristics and values that kept couples together — and this is what eHarmony was built around. Like most other sites, when you join, you answer a questionnaire that asks about your likes and dislikes to better determine your best matches. Additionally, you fill out a personality profile so that others can get a good idea of who you are.

5. Zoosk

Zoosk has millions of members and an A+ Better Business Bureau rating. While it isn’t the largest site out there, it’s ideal for those looking to meet up with someone in their area. Because it has fewer members than the other sites, not everyone will have success finding a match. With that being said, Zoosk is great for most people looking for a relationship. When you join, you’ll fill out a questionnaire like most other online dating sites. Then, you can view singles in your area and decide who you want to date.
